Securing a Certificate of Insurance (COI) is a mandatory step for almost every high-rise in Boca Raton or Miami. A COI is a formal document verifying that a moving company carries active liability and workers’ compensation insurance to cover potential damages to the building. Without this specific paperwork, most facilities won’t allow movers onto the property. We ensure this documentation is sent to the facility manager well before the truck arrives.
Step-by-Step Facility Coordination
Successful moves rely on a strict timeline. Senior communities operate on precise schedules to maintain a peaceful environment for residents. This is why the “moving window” is non-negotiable. If your scheduled time is between 9:00 AM and 1:00 PM, arriving late can result in a canceled move. To avoid this, we recommend a methodical coordination checklist:
- Elevator Reservations: Confirm your dedicated freight elevator at least 14 days in advance to avoid conflicts with food service or other residents.
- Loading Dock Clearance: Verify truck height restrictions, especially in urban centers like Miami where docks can be surprisingly low.
- Floor Protection: Check if the facility requires specific materials like Masonite or plastic runners to protect their carpeting and tile.

Protecting Belongings from Heat and Humidity
Using standard plastic wrap can actually be detrimental in our region. It often traps moisture against wood surfaces, leading to clouding, warping, or mold growth. During a typical four-hour move, South Florida’s high humidity can cause the wood fibers in antique furniture to expand and contract rapidly, potentially leading to permanent structural cracks or finish damage. To prevent this, we use breathable moving blankets and specialized furniture protection techniques. Senior Comfort and Safety on Moving Day
The safety of the senior involved is our primary concern. We recommend preparing an “Essentials Box” that stays in a cool, accessible place, such as a family member’s car. This box should contain:
- Daily medications and health records.
- Cold bottled water and light snacks.
- Important legal and facility documents.
During the move, we help establish a “Quiet Zone” within the home. This is a designated room with active air conditioning and comfortable seating where the senior can relax away from the noise and activity.
